This cocktail was created by Christian Leduc (@christianleduc79), who sent it my way via Instagram and encouraged me to give it a try. He wanted a lighter take on a Martinez, borrowing the idea of a reverse Martini and letting sweet vermouth take the lead. The mole bitters bring in a little chocolate and spice, which plays nicely with the maraschino and keeps the drink feeling a bit more layered than your usual low-proof sipper.Cheers y'all!
Ingredients
- 1½ oz · 45 mlsweet vermouth
- ½ oz · 15 mlgin
- ¼ oz · 7.5 mlmaraschino liqueur
- 2 dashesmole bitters
Method
- 1
Add all ingredients to a mixing glass.
- 2
Add ice and stir until chilled.
- 3
Strain into a chilled coupe.
- 4
Garnish with a brandied cherry.
